We had one notable sighting this week. On Saturday morning, the large cluster of hawk watchers had the pleasure of observing a low flying Short-eared Owl circling overhead at Hawk Hill. A spirited challenge from a local Red-tailed Hawk encouraged its departure southward to the lake shore. The park is operated by the City of Toronto Parks Department. The Count site (Hawk Hill) is located on a small hill at the north end of the Grenadier Restaurant parking lot. It is located about 1.5km (1 mile) north of Lake Ontario, at an elevation of 110 metres above sea level and 38 metres above Lake Ontario. The site location is N 43 degrees 37 minutes 03.8 seconds, W 79 degrees 28 minutes 56.5 seconds. This station is at the highest point and near the centre of the park; a steep slope that descends to a large pond is immediately west of the station. Full time counts have been recorded here since 1993.
